The Core Problem: Digital vs. Analog Hassle
Here’s the blunt truth: a pendrive (or USB flash drive, if you prefer) is a digital storage device. It speaks the language of ones and zeros. A VGA monitor, on the other hand, is an analog display. It speaks the language of fluctuating voltages representing color and brightness. They don’t naturally understand each other. You can’t just plug a USB drive directly into a VGA port like you might plug a USB mouse into a computer. The physical connectors are different, and more importantly, the *data signals* are fundamentally incompatible.
Think of it like trying to play a Blu-ray disc on a VCR. The formats are just too different. You need a translator, a bridge between these two worlds. And that bridge, in the case of getting your pendrive’s content onto a VGA monitor, involves a computer or a specific type of media player.
Why Direct Connection Is a Myth
You’ll see a lot of garbage online claiming you can directly connect a pendrive to a VGA monitor. These are typically either clickbait or a misunderstanding of what’s actually happening. There’s no magical USB-to-VGA adapter that takes a USB drive’s data and miraculously outputs it as an analog VGA signal without an intermediary processing device. Any device claiming to do this is almost certainly misrepresenting itself or is actually a media player with a USB port.

The common advice you find suggests buying a ‘USB to VGA adapter’. This is where the confusion usually starts. These adapters *don’t* work with a pendrive directly. They are designed to connect a computer’s USB port to a VGA monitor. The computer handles the digital-to-analog conversion. The pendrive still needs to be plugged into the computer first.
So, What’s the Actual Solution?
The simplest and most reliable way to get your pendrive content onto a VGA monitor is to use a device that can *read* the pendrive and *output* a VGA signal. The most common device for this is a laptop or a desktop computer. You plug your pendrive into the computer, and then you connect the computer’s video output (which might be VGA, HDMI, or DisplayPort) to the VGA monitor using an appropriate cable or adapter.
If you’re presenting, you’re likely already using a laptop. Plug the pendrive into the laptop. Then, connect the laptop’s video output to the VGA monitor. Most laptops will have HDMI or DisplayPort these days. If your laptop only has HDMI and the monitor only has VGA, you’ll need an HDMI-to-VGA adapter. These adapters are common and relatively inexpensive. They take the digital signal from your laptop’s HDMI port and convert it into an analog signal for the VGA monitor.
Tip: Make sure the adapter you buy is *active*. Passive adapters rely on the source device to provide some conversion power, which isn’t always reliable. An active adapter has its own small circuitry to do the conversion.
Alternative Gadgets for the Technologically Brave (or Desperate)
Sometimes, you don’t have a laptop handy, or you just want a simpler, dedicated solution. This is where dedicated media players come in. Many modern digital signage players or portable media players have a USB port for content playback and a VGA output. These devices are designed to read files from USB drives and display them on a screen.

Key considerations for media players:
- File Format Support: Ensure the player supports the video or image formats on your pendrive. Not all players are created equal; some are picky about codecs and container types.
- Output Resolution: Check that the player’s VGA output resolution matches or can be adjusted to match your monitor’s native resolution for the clearest picture.
- Ease of Use: Some are plug-and-play, others require complex setup menus. For a quick presentation, you want something dead simple.
The USB-to-Vga Adapter Nuance: What People Actually Mean
Let’s circle back to that ‘USB to VGA adapter’. When people search for ‘how to connect pendrive to vga monitor’ and find results about these adapters, they’re often looking for a solution where the USB drive itself is the *source* and the VGA adapter is the *output*. This simply doesn’t exist as a standalone device for direct pendrive-to-VGA conversion. The adapters you *can* buy are USB *graphics adapters*. They plug into a computer’s USB port and provide a VGA output. So, the computer is still the ‘brain’ doing the work.
Here’s a breakdown of what these adapters *actually* do:
| Device | Connects To | Purpose | Opinion/Verdict |
|---|---|---|---|
| Pendrive (USB Drive) | Computer USB Port | Stores digital files (presentations, videos, etc.) | Essential for carrying data, but useless without a reader. |
| USB-to-VGA Adapter (Graphics Adapter) | Computer USB Port & VGA Monitor | Allows a computer with no native VGA port to connect to a VGA monitor. Handles digital-to-analog conversion. | Useful for extending display options on a computer, but NOT for direct pendrive connection. Needs a computer to function. |
| HDMI-to-VGA Adapter | HDMI Source (Laptop) & VGA Monitor | Converts digital HDMI signal to analog VGA signal. | A common and reliable solution if your source has HDMI and your display has VGA. Requires an HDMI source. |
| Dedicated Media Player | USB Drive & VGA Monitor | Reads files from USB drive and outputs video directly to VGA. | Potentially the easiest standalone solution if you don’t have a computer, but check file compatibility. |

Troubleshooting Common Pitfalls
So, you’ve got your setup: computer (or media player) connected to the VGA monitor, and your pendrive is plugged into the computer. What if it still doesn’t work? Here are a few things that have tripped me up:
- Resolution Mismatch: The computer is trying to output a resolution that the VGA monitor can’t handle. Go into your computer’s display settings and try a lower resolution, like 800×600 or 1024×768. Sometimes, older VGA monitors are very picky.
- Bad Cable or Adapter: VGA cables can degrade over time. The pins can get bent, or the shielding can fail. Try a different VGA cable or adapter if you have one. I once spent twenty minutes troubleshooting a presentation, only to find a bent pin on the VGA cable connector. It looked fine from a distance, but up close, one pin was mangled.
- Driver Issues (for USB Graphics Adapters): If you’re using a USB-to-VGA *graphics adapter* with a computer, it might need specific drivers installed. Check the manufacturer’s website. Without the right drivers, the adapter is just a useless brick.
- Power: Some active adapters require external power via a USB-A port. Make sure this connection is made if needed.
